II. A Step-by-Step Guide: How to Obtain a Copy of Your Tax Return Online

The first step in getting a copy of your tax return online is to gather the necessary information. You will need personal identification, such as a Social Security number, name, and date of birth. You will also need to know which specific tax year(s) for which you are looking to obtain a return.

The next step is to go to the IRS website. After navigating to the website, you will need to click on the “Get Transcript Online” link. You will then enter your personal information to confirm your identity, and select the tax year(s) for which you need copies of your tax returns. Once you have confirmed your identity and selected the desired tax year(s), you will be able to download and print your return(s).

If you have any trouble accessing the website or navigating the process, online tax preparation services like H&R Block and TurboTax can help. These services offer additional support and can walk you through the process step-by-step.

VI. Understanding The System: How To Recover Lost or Stolen Tax Returns Online

Sometimes you might lose your original tax return through theft, natural disaster, or some other catastrophic event. If this occurs, you’ll need to take steps to obtain a copy of your past returns and protect your identity during the process. To start this process, you’ll need to request a PIN from the IRS so that no one else can access your sensitive tax information.

If the situation is more complex, you might want to reach out to customer service or find an experienced tax professional who can help you sort out the process. It’s especially important to be careful when dealing with online transactions concerning personal information like tax returns. Only use websites that are secure and legitimate.
